Purpose of Role:
To work under the supervision of the responsible pharmacist to ensure the safe, accurate and timely supply of prescribed medication to patients. Provide medicines-related and healthy lifestyle advice to patients as well as assisting in the smooth operation of the pharmacy.
Reports to: Responsible Pharmacist, Pharmacy Manager, Supervisor
Duties of the Role:
- Support the pharmacist with dispensary operations
- Ordering of dispensary stock and medicines in line with company policy
- Select, label and dispense pharmaceutical products in accordance with a prescription by following Standard Operating Procedures and complying with all legal requirements.
- Ensure the safe and correct handover of dispensed items to patients.
- Accurately maintain Patient Medication Records to ensure patient safety in accordance with data protection requirements.
- Identify prescription queries and bring these to the attention of the pharmacist.
- Answer queries on the supply and availability of medicines, where it is within your competence.
- Receive stock in accordance with Standard Operating Procedures.
- Ensure the safe and appropriate storage of medicines including refrigerated items.
- Assist with stock control and the maintenance of reasonable stock levels within the dispensary and ensure that urgent orders are processed.
- Liaise with other healthcare professionals to assist in the continuity of patient care across primary and secondary care.
- Receive prescriptions from counter staff and ensure they are dispensed in a timely manner.
- Assist in providing pharmaceutical care to patients by carrying out reasonable duties as determined by the needs of the business.
- Promote the pharmacy to be the patients choice for the electronic prescription service.
- Supporting the pharmacist to ensure that prescriptions are ready for the delivery driver.
- Prepare dosette boxes accurately following correct company procedure.
- Adhere to repeat dispensing within the agreed time frames.
- Ensure all prescriptions are completed correctly by the customer.
- Ensure that prescriptions are filed at the end of each day and ready to send to NHS monthly.
- Carry out stock count and date checks for controlled drugs.
- Ensure that the pharmacy dispensary is kept clean and tidy at all times, adhering to the cleaning rota.

Required Qualifications and Job Skills:
- Qualifications:
- To have completed an accredited NVQ level 2 (or equivalent) Dispensing Assistant training course, or to be working towards the accredited course under the guidance of the pharmacist within 12 months.
